Raising Awareness through Engaging Media

One of the most effective ways to reach a broad audience and ignite public interest in conservation is through engaging media platforms. Documentaries, films, and television programs can vividly showcase the beauty and fragility of endangered species, highlighting the consequences of their loss. These mediums can effectively convey the interconnectedness of ecosystems and the impact of human actions on the survival of these creatures. Furthermore, social media campaigns, utilizing captivating visuals and compelling narratives, can effectively disseminate information and inspire action. By leveraging the power of storytelling and visual communication, these platforms can effectively raise awareness about the importance of pelestarian hewan dan tumbuhan langka.

Empowering Education in Schools

Formal education plays a crucial role in shaping future generations' attitudes and behaviors towards conservation. Integrating pelestarian hewan dan tumbuhan langka into school curricula can foster a sense of responsibility and stewardship among young minds. Interactive lessons, field trips to wildlife sanctuaries, and hands-on activities can provide students with a deeper understanding of the ecological significance of these species. By engaging students in real-world conservation projects, such as habitat restoration or wildlife monitoring, schools can empower them to become active advocates for biodiversity.

Community Engagement and Collaboration

Engaging local communities in conservation efforts is essential for creating a sustainable and impactful approach. Community-based initiatives, such as nature walks, workshops, and educational talks, can provide valuable opportunities for residents to learn about the importance of pelestarian hewan dan tumbuhan langka in their own backyards. By fostering a sense of ownership and responsibility, these initiatives can empower communities to become active participants in conservation efforts. Collaboration with local organizations, NGOs, and government agencies can further amplify the reach and impact of these initiatives.

Promoting Sustainable Practices

Raising awareness about the importance of pelestarian hewan dan tumbuhan langka extends beyond simply understanding the ecological consequences of their loss. It also involves promoting sustainable practices that minimize human impact on these species and their habitats. Educating consumers about responsible consumption, such as choosing sustainably sourced products and reducing waste, can significantly contribute to conservation efforts. Furthermore, promoting eco-tourism initiatives that prioritize responsible wildlife viewing and habitat preservation can help generate revenue for conservation projects while minimizing disturbance to endangered species.
